Hot Air Dryers and Ultrasonic Cleaners

When ultrasonic waves are applied to objects, the objects must be immersed in a liquid bath in order for cavitation bubbles to form.

This bubbling action removes impurities and cleans the objects more thoroughly than any other method.

However, if the objects are water-absorbent, or simply contain a lot of complex surface area, water may be retained.

If allowed to dry at normal speeds, water may be retained, drying times are impractically long, and “water spots” caused by residual minerals may remain after the water has evaporated, due to slow evaporation. Omegasonics’ hot air dryers can achieve the optimal results you seek.

Omegasonics and Hot Air Dryers

Once items emerge from an ultrasonic cleaning unit, they still must be dried quickly to maintain their pristine state. Omegasonics’ hot air dryers, such as the Viking 6800, use a gentle updraft drying method that safely and quickly completes the job.

Air heated to the optimal temperature of 160°F flows from the bottom up and re-circulates around the parts until they are dry, providing an excellent and cost-effective solution to the problems of slow and imperfect drying of objects cleaned by ultrasonic waves in a cleansing bath.

Hot air dryers such as the Viking 6800 and the 6900TD (tunnel dryer), though an initially pricey investment, give a quick ROI due to their effect on cleaning turnaround time and quality of drying. Like ultrasonic cleaners, they require little training and supervision, freeing up workers to be utilized elsewhere and increasing overall production.

Our Hot Air Dryers Specifications

Omegasonics offers two models of hot air dryer. The 6800 comes in two sizes and features an up-draft recirculating hot air dryer with an 1100 CFM blower and 5700 watts heat.

Components consist of programmable digital temperature controls and a digital timer-controlled process time. It sports a Hammertone powder coated frame, hinged or sliding doors are available options, and its four locking swivel casters ensure portability. It comes with a 2-year guarantee.

The Omegasonics 6900TD (Tunnel Dryer) features many of the same specifications, with a few differences. For example, the doors are “guillotine style,” ensuring faster overall processing and drying times, and it consists of a conveyor belt which feeds the parts which need drying through automatically, increasing ROI and allowing personnel to be reassigned to other duties.
